I would like to automate the copying of report files (.xsl) into sharepoint. Does someone have a script that will do this (preferably windows cmd or powershell).

Here's a PowerShell script to upload files:
# Set a few variables $file = "C:\test\myTestFile.txt" $webUrl = "http://server/sites/yoursite" $library = "Team Documents" $overWriteExisting = $True #or add new version if versioning enabled # do a little SharePoint setup $web = Get-SPWeb $webUrl $files = $web.GetFolder($library).Files $fileNameForLibrary = $file.Substring($file.LastIndexOf("\")+1) # read the file $data = Get-ChildItem $file # add any needed metadata $metadata = @{ "Project ID" = "A-200"; "Region" = "North" } # or if no metadata needed: $metadata = @{} # do the upload (the following is one line) $newfile = $files.Add($library + "/" + $fileNameForLibrary, $data.OpenRead(), $metadata, $overWriteExisting)
